Transaction 2330d76e57a15b91bb0f81f5265223dc2508d139efb4e26ed566b72578a7378a

1 Input
2 Outputs
  • 2330d76e57a15b91bb0f81f5265223dc2508d139efb4e26ed566b72578a7378a:0
  • value  2677803
    address  3MaxhudsWJXf45fbXMZ1nvNGkCA4FCZ2gj
  • 2330d76e57a15b91bb0f81f5265223dc2508d139efb4e26ed566b72578a7378a:1
  • value  1540244
    address  1PeZbUAMyvdEPZaUQ4ccPquMKAvS9q7Ktw